Lohja is defined by its flooded industrial and quarry sites, with the Ojamo Mine standing out as a technical diving destination. The mine requires advanced cave or technical certification and descends between twenty-eight and forty metres through submerged shafts and tunnels, with visibility that can reach thirty metres. Alongside the mine, the area offers shallower sites including wall dives and an open quarry suitable for beginners, so the range spans two metres to fifty-five metres overall. All sites are shore-entry. Water temperatures are cold year-round, sitting near four degrees Celsius at depth in the mine and varying seasonally at the shallower sites.
